Paula G. Ferreira is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ology and Animal Science and Zoology. According to data from OpenAlex, Paula G. Ferreira has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 406 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Infectious Diseases, 11 papers in Epidemiology and 10 papers in Animal Science and Zoology. Recurrent topics in Paula G. Ferreira’s work include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(12 papers), Viral Diseases in Livestock and Poultry (8 papers) and Immune Cell Function and Interaction (5 papers). Paula G. Ferreira is often cited by papers focused on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(12 papers), Viral Diseases in Livestock and Poultry (8 papers) and Immune Cell Function and Interaction (5 papers). Paula G. Ferreira coll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, Spain and France. Paula G. Ferreira's co-authors include Artur P. Águas, Maria João Oliveira, Luzia Teixeira, Raquel M. Marques, Eliseu Monteiro, Paulo Vaz‐Pires, Manuel Vilanova, Alexandra Correia, Paulo Martins da Costa and Márcia Dinis and has published in prestigious journals such as Genetics, Scientific Reports and World Journal of Gastroenterology.
